Poll shows Daschle with slim lead

Associated Press


Seven months before the November general election, Democratic U.S. Sen. Tom Daschle holds a lead of 5.6 percentage points over Republican challenger John Thune, according to results of a new statewide poll.

Of the 501 likely voters polled, 48.2 percent said they supported Daschle, while 42.6 percent favored Thune. Nearly 8 percent were undecided and 1 percent said they did not support either candidate.

The poll has a margin of error of plus or minus 4.5 percent. Daschle, a three-term incumbent, and Thune, a former three-term member of the U.S. House, will face each other in the general election on Nov. 2.

The poll was conducted March 27-28 by Zogby International, of Utica, N.Y. It commissioned by several South Dakota media outlets, including the Rapid City Journal, the Watertown Public Opinion, KOTA-TV of Rapid City and KSFY-TV of Sioux Falls.
